About

Maria Prandini is a leading figure in the fields of hybrid systems, control theory, and autonomous robotics. Her research focuses on developing rigorous, safety-critical control frameworks for complex, multi-agent systems operating in uncertain environments. A cornerstone of her work is the integration of discrete and continuous dynamics to ensure safe human-robot interaction, as exemplified by her 2018 paper on hybrid control for manipulators in human-robot coexistence scenarios. This work, which has garnered 3 citations, formulates safe motion planning as an optimal control problem with distinct safety modes. More recently, Prandini has advanced the state of the art in automated infrastructure inspection, as demonstrated by her highly cited 2023 paper on automated photovoltaic power plant inspection via unmanned vehicles (16 citations). This work addresses the critical problem of assigning inspection targets to a heterogeneous fleet of UAVs and UGVs to minimize operational costs. Through these contributions, Prandini has established herself as a key innovator in the safe and efficient deployment of autonomous systems, bridging the gap between theoretical control design and practical, high-impact applications.
